Merge pull request #1274 from WhileLoop/fix-acm-expiration-check

Fix timezone mismatch in acm certificate created date and now date check
This commit is contained in:
Jack Danger 2017-10-19 13:35:32 -07:00 committed by GitHub
commit d63040c5d1

View File

@ -170,7 +170,7 @@ class CertBundle(BaseModel):
try:
self._cert = cryptography.x509.load_pem_x509_certificate(self.cert, default_backend())
now = datetime.datetime.now()
now = datetime.datetime.utcnow()
if self._cert.not_valid_after < now:
raise AWSValidationException('The certificate has expired, is not valid.')